Class ReportBuilderOptions
Namespace: Aspose.Words.LowCode
Assembly: Aspose.Words.dll
Representerar alternativ för funktionaliteten i LINQ Reporting Engine.
public class ReportBuilderOptions
Arv
Arvda Medlemmar
object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Konstruktörer
ReportBuilderOptions()
public ReportBuilderOptions()
Egenskaper
KnownTypes
Hämtar en oordnad uppsättning (d.v.s. en samling av unika objekt) som innehåller System.Type-objekt vars fullständiga eller delvis kvalificerade namn kan användas inom rapportmallar som bearbetas av denna motor instans för att anropa motsvarande typers statiska medlemmar, utföra typkonverteringar, etc.
public KnownTypeSet KnownTypes { get; }
Egenskapsvärde
KnownTypeSet
MissingMemberMessage
Hämtar eller ställer in ett strängvärde som skrivs ut istället för ett malluttryck som representerar en enkel referens till en saknad medlem av ett objekt. Standardvärdet är en tom sträng.
public string MissingMemberMessage { get; set; }
Egenskapsvärde
Kommentarer
Egenskapen bör användas tillsammans med Aspose.Words.Reporting.ReportBuildOptions.AllowMissingMembers alternativet. Annars kastas ett undantag när en saknad medlem av ett objekt stöter på.
Egenskapen påverkar endast utskrift av ett malluttryck som representerar en enkel referens till en saknad objektmedlem. Till exempel, utskrift av en binär operator, där en av operandena refererar till en saknad objektmedlem, påverkas inte.
Värdet av denna egenskap kan inte sättas till null.
Options
Hämtar eller ställer in en uppsättning flaggor som kontrollerar beteendet hos denna Aspose.Words.Reporting.ReportingEngine-instans vid byggande av en rapport.
public ReportBuildOptions Options { get; set; }